This repository contains files for applications to support i.MX7 Nokia 3210 Mainboard
In addition to the required packages given by the android source.android.com/source/initializing.html these packages are needed as well:
$ sudo apt install uuid uuid-dev
$ sudo apt install zlib1g-dev liblz-dev
$ sudo apt install liblzo2-2 liblzo2-dev
$ sudo apt install lzop
$ sudo apt install git-core curl
$ sudo apt install u-boot-tools
$ sudo apt install mtd-utils
$ sudo apt install android-tools-fsutils
$ sudo apt install openjdk-8-jdk
$ sudo apt install python-lunch
$ mkdir android
$ cd android
$ repo init -u https://android.googlesource.com/platform/manifest -b android-7.1.1_r13
$ repo sync
Cloning into Android will download 100+ different git repositores. So it will take some time.
$ git clone git://git.freescale.com/imx/linux-imx.git kernel_imx
$ cd kernel_imx
$ git checkout n7.1.1_1.0.0-ga
Cloning into the imx Kernel will take some time as well
$ cd ..
$ cd bootable
$ mkdir bootloader
$ cd bootloader
$ git clone git://git.freescale.com/imx/uboot-imx.git uboot-imx
$ cd uboot-imx
$ git checkout n7.1.1_1.0.0-ga
After getting the sources we can patch the needed code changes for running Android on the i.MX7D platform
$ cd ..
$ source [wherever you downloaded the NXP android sources to]/android_N7.1.1_1.0.0_source/code/N7.1.1_1.0.0/and_patch.sh
$ c_patch [wherever you downloaded the NXP android sources to]/android_N7.1.1_1.0.0_source/code/N7.1.1_1.0.0/ imx_N7.1.1_1.0.0
This will run over the repositories and change stuff where change is needed. This will take a while
*************************************************************
Success: Now you can build android code for FSL i.MX platform
*************************************************************
This message shows you that all patches are applied and we can start building Android.
$ source build/envsetup.sh
$ lunch
$ make 2>&1 | tee build-log.txt
Building Android will take a lot of time. Really a lot of time.
